What is an Auto Locksmith?

Auto locksmiths are professionals trained in handling vehicle locking systems. Their knowledge encompasses a variety of tasks, from duplicating keys to programming transponders and opening locked vehicles without triggering damage. The following table summarizes the key services used by auto locksmiths:

ServiceDescription
Lockout ServicesGetting entry when keys are lost or locked inside the vehicle.
Key DuplicationCreating a duplicate key for a vehicle.
Key ReplacementChanging lost or broken keys, consisting of smart keys.
Ignition Repair/ReplacementFixing or changing malfunctioning ignition systems.
Transponder Key ProgrammingProgramming transponder keys for newer vehicle models.
Emergency situation ServicesOffering 24/7 service for urgent lock concerns.
Lock RepairsFixing or replacing harmed locks on cars.

Why are Auto Locksmiths Important?

1. 24/7 Availability

Auto locksmiths use emergency situation services, providing support at any hour of the day or night. Whether it's a flat tire in the middle of the night or a forgotten key inside a locked car, their day-and-night availability is vital.

2. Knowledge and Training

Auto locksmiths go through substantial training to comprehend modern vehicle locking innovations. They are equipped to deal with complex electronic systems that a lot of car owners are not familiar with, making sure that the work is done efficiently and properly.

3. Prevents Damage

Attempting to open a vehicle without the appropriate tools can cause expensive damage. Auto locksmiths feature specialized tools designed to get entry without hurting the vehicle, thus saving car owners from potential repair expenses.

4. Key Replacement for All Types of Vehicles

Whether you own a vintage car or a new design with high-tech locking systems, auto locksmiths have the understanding to produce or change keys for various vehicle types.

5. Cost-Effectiveness

Working with an auto locksmith can be more cost-effective than looking for help from a car dealership, especially for key replacements and repair work. This can save money and time for car owners.

Common Auto Locksmith Services and Their Costs

The costs related to auto locksmith services can vary depending on the service needed and the complexity of the task. The following table provides an introduction of common services and their approximate expenses:

ServiceAverage Cost
Emergency Situation Lockout Service₤ 60 - ₤ 120
Key Duplication₤ 2 - ₤ 10 per key
Key Replacement₤ 100 - ₤ 300
Ignition Repair₤ 100 - ₤ 200
Transponder Key Programming₤ 50 - ₤ 150
Lock Repairs₤ 50 - ₤ 200

Note:

Prices might vary based on area, the locksmith's proficiency, and the particular vehicle make and model.

How to Choose the Right Auto Locksmith

Discovering the right auto locksmith can appear overwhelming sometimes. Here are some key factors to consider when picking a professional:

  1. Reputation and Reviews: Look for locksmiths with favorable customer feedback and solid track records in your community.

  2. Certifications: Ensure that the locksmith is accredited and guaranteed, which is important for your defense.

  3. Service Range: Choose a locksmith who provides a large range of services to satisfy your existing and future needs.

  4. Schedule: Opt for a locksmith that provides 24/7 services, particularly if you may encounter emergency situations.

  5. Cost Transparency: A trusted locksmith needs to provide clear and in advance pricing without concealed fees.

  6. Local Knowledge: Hiring a regional locksmith can be useful, as they often have a much better understanding of local vehicle models and locking systems.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q1: Can auto locksmiths open my car without a key?

A: Yes, auto locksmiths are trained to unlock automobiles without keys. They use various tools and strategies to gain entry while guaranteeing no damage is done to the vehicle.

Q2: What should I do if I've lost my car keys?

A: Contact an auto locksmith who can change or make a new key for your vehicle. In some cases, they might require to reprogram the vehicle's locking system.

Q3: How long does it take for an auto locksmith to open my car?

A: The time it takes can vary, but usually it varies from 5 to 30 minutes, depending upon the locking mechanism and the locksmith's skill level.

Q4: Are auto locksmith services covered by insurance coverage?

A: Many insurance coverage policies include protection for locksmith services. It's best to talk to your insurance coverage provider for particular details.

Q5: Can auto locksmiths manage electronic or smart keys?

A: Yes, many auto locksmiths are trained to deal with modern-day electronic and smart key systems, consisting of shows transponders and key fobs.
